Latest Patents

Nakatani's latest patents include a thin-sample-piece fabricating device and a thin-sample-piece fabricating method. The thin-sample-piece fabricating device is equipped with a focused-ion-beam irradiation optical system, a stage, a stage driving mechanism, and a computer. This device allows for precise irradiation with a focused ion beam (FIB) to create thin samples. The method of preparing thin film sample pieces involves a series of processes that ensure the integrity of the sample while utilizing the focused ion beam for etching and separation.
